Learn more about Scotia

This historic company town showcases California's timber heritage at the Scotia Museum with its fascinating mill artefacts and photographs. Join a guided tour of the still-operating Scotia sawmill to see massive redwood logs transformed into timber while learning about sustainable forestry practices.

Best time to go to Scotia

The best time to visit Scotia is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. February is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January46.9°F (8.3°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March46.6°F (8.1°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yHighAverage
April49.1°F (9.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
May52.7°F (11.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
June56.8°F (13.8°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July60.3°F (15.7°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
August61.3°F (16.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
September59.9°F (15.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
October55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owAverage
November50.0°F (10.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low
December46.2°F (7.9°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yLowAverage

What's the weather like in Scotia?
The hottest months are usually August and September,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are March and February, with an average of 8°C. The rainiest months in Scotia are December, March, January and February, with each month seeing an average of 199 mm of rainfall.
